Background/Aims: Autoimmune hepatitis, primary biliary cirrhosis and primary sclerosing cholangitis are chronic liver diseases with probable autoimmune background. Overlapping features have been described for primary biliary cirrhosis and autoimmune hepatitis. In contrast, there have been only a few case reports on an overlap of autoimmune hepatitis and primary sclerosing cholangitis.Methods: We describe three male patients with clinical and histological overlapping features of primary sclerosing cholangitis and autoimmune hepatitis.Results: All initially asymptomatic patients had elevated levels of aminotransferases, alkaline phosphatase, γ-glutamyltranspeptidase and IgG. Anti-nuclear antibodies and/or smooth muscle antibodies were positive and anti-neutrophil cytoplasmic antibodies were detected in all patients. Retrograde endoscopic cholangiography showed bile-duct strictures characteristic for primary sclerosing cholangitis. Histopathology showed necro-inflammatory activity of portal tracts with bridging necrosis in all patients at the time of first diagnosis. Aminotransferase levels and the necro-inflammatory activity responded well to immuno-suppressive treatment. Predominant periductular fibrosis as a typical histopathological feature of primary sclerosing cirrhosis was seen to develop in all patients. Cholestatic serum parameters remained elevated and periductular fibrosis as endoscopic bile duct changes progressed despite immunosuppression.Conclusions: We suggest that these patients present an overlap syndrome of autoimmune hepatitis and primary sclerosing cholangitis as they fulfill the diagnostic criteria for both conditions.  相似文献

Liver transplantation is indicated for terminal phases of autoimmune hepatitis, primary biliary cirrhosis and primary sclerosing cholangitis. Indications for transplantation in autoimmune liver diseases are similar to those used in other acute or chronic liver diseases. Therapeutic advances have reduced the need for transplantation for autoimmune hepatitis and primary biliary cirrhosis but not for primary sclerosing cholangitis. Overall, outcomes of transplantation for autoimmune liver diseases are excellent. However, recurrence of autoimmune liver diseases in the allograft has variable impacts on graft and patient survivals. Treatment of recurrent diseases requires changes in immunosuppression or addition of ursodeoxycholic acid. Among autoimmune liver diseases, only autoimmune hepatitis occurs de novo in recipients transplanted for other diseases. Patients transplanted for autoimmune hepatitis or primary sclerosing cholangitis are at risk for reactivation or de novo onset of ulcerative colitis. Better understanding of the pathogenesis of recurrent autoimmune liver diseases is needed to devise effective means of prevention and treatment.  相似文献

Shared Genetic Risk Factors in Autoimmune Liver Disease   总被引:6,自引:0,他引:6  
To determine if shared genetic risk factors for autoimmune liver disease affect clinical manifestations, we evaluated 271 patients and 92 normal subjects by DNA-based techniques. Genetic risk factors were intermixed in all conditions, and frequency varied according to disease type. DR4 distinguished autoimmune hepatitis (P = 0.0002) and primary biliary cirrhosis (P = 0.004) from primary sclerosing cholangitis. DR52 distinguished primary sclerosing cholangitis from autoimmune hepatitis (P = 0.0007) and primary biliary cirrhosis (P = 0.00007) and DR3 distinguished autoimmune hepatitis (P = 0.002) and primary sclerosing cholangitis (P = 0.0005) from primary biliary cirrhosis. Only the occurrence of DR4 in primary sclerosing cholangitis was lower than in normal subjects (P = 0.02). Patients with mixed genetic risk factors did not have distinctive features or manifestations of hybrid conditions. We conclude that patients with shared genetic risk factors do not have characteristic features nor do they have overlap syndromes. DR4 may be protective against primary sclerosing cholangitis.  相似文献

Abstract: Perinuclear antineutrophil cytoplasmic autoantibodies have been described in inflammatory bowel diseases and in primary sclerosing cholangitis. Because the data concerning their occurrence are conflicting, we have used indirect immunofluorescence on ethanol-fixed neutrophils to test the sera from a large population of 382 patients with various liver and digestive diseases: in particular, from 27 patients with primary sclerosing cholangitis, 105 patients with autoimmune chronic active hepatitis, 30 patients with primary biliary cirrhosis and 124 patients with inflammatory bowel disease. The prevalence of the perinuclear antineutrophil cytoplasmic autoantibodies was 37% in ulcerative colitis and 15% in Crohn's disease. They would not be helpful in the differential diagnosis between these two inflammatory bowel diseases. Within the group of autoimmune liver diseases, perinuclear antineutrophil cytoplasmic autoantibodies were detected in 44% of sera from patients with primary sclerosing cholangitis and in 36% of sera from patients with type I autoimmune active hepatitis, but not in primary biliary cirrhosis. When primary sclerosing cholangitis was associated with an inflammatory bowel disease, the prevalence of these autoantibodies was 60%. They were 88% specific for primary sclerosing cholangitis and 86% specific for type I autoimmune active hepatitis. Despite their moderate sensitivity and specificity in primary sclerosing cholangitis, they remain the only serologic marker of this autoimmune liver disease. Moreover, they turned out to be a more sensitive marker for inflammatory bowel disease with associated primary sclerosing cholangitis  相似文献

Overlap syndromes between autoimmune hepatitis and both primary biliary cirrhosis and primary sclerosing cholangitis are well described, but overlap between primary biliary cirrhosis and primary sclerosing cholangitis is not recognized. We present two cases of an unusual autoimmune liver disease, both of which included an overlap between primary biliary cirrhosis and primary sclerosing cholangitis, while one had features of all three conditions. The diagnoses were based on clinical, biochemical, serological, histological and cholangiographic findings. The two cases were identified from a consecutive cohort of 261 patients with autoimmune liver disease followed prospectively in secondary care over a 20-year period, which gives perspective to this uncommon overlap syndrome.  相似文献

OBJECTIVE: To determine any relationship between polymorphisms in the genes encoding tumour necrosis factor alpha (TNFalpha), interleukin-10 (IL-10) and transforming growth factor beta1 (TGFbeta1) and end-stage liver disease. METHODS: Whole-blood samples were taken from patients attending the Scottish Liver Transplant Unit with end-stage liver disease (primary biliary cirrhosis, n = 61; alcoholic liver disease, n = 25; primary sclerosing cholangitis, n = 17; viral disease, n = 8; type 1 auto-immune hepatitis, n = 8; acute liver failure, n = 20). DNA was extracted and the polymorphisms at positions TNF -308, IL-10 -1082 and TGFbeta1 +869 and +915 were determined using sequence-specific oligonucleotide probes. Samples were also analysed from normal healthy controls. RESULTS: There was a significant difference between patients with primary sclerosing cholangitis and healthy controls, with 65% of patients (11/17) possessing at least one TNF2 allele (A at position -308) compared with 38% of controls (P = 0.02). Four of the eight patients with auto-immune hepatitis were homozygous for TNF2 while the other four were heterozygous (P = 0.001). No significant difference between controls and patients was seen in polymorphisms for IL-10 or TGFbeta1. No association between genotype and Child's class was found in primary biliary cirrhosis. CONCLUSION: Patients with primary sclerosing cholangitis and auto-immune hepatitis are more likely to possess TNF2 than normal controls. This allele has been associated with an increased production of TNFalpha in vitro and may indicate a predisposition to these inflammatory conditions.  相似文献

BACKGROUND/AIMS: The clinical relevance of anti-neutrophil cytoplasmic antibodies (ANCA) in autoimmune liver disease is unclear. Defining the antigenic specificities of ANCA in these diseases may improve their clinical significance. METHODS: We studied the target antigens of ANCA in 88 patients with autoimmune hepatitis, 53 patients with primary biliary cirrhosis, and 55 patients with primary sclerosing cholangitis by indirect immunofluorescence, antigen-specific enzyme-linked immunosorbent assays, and immunodetection on Western blot, using an extract of whole neutrophils as a substrate. We related the data to clinical symptoms of autoimmune liver disease. RESULTS: By indirect immunofluorescence, ANCA were present in 74% of patients with autoimmune hepatitis, 26% of patients with primary biliary cirrhosis, and 60% of patients with primary sclerosing cholangitis. Major antigens were catalase, alpha-enolase, and lactoferrin. The presence of ANCA as detected by indirect immunofluorescence was associated with the occurrence of relapses in autoimmune hepatitis, with decreased liver synthesis function in primary biliary cirrhosis and in primary sclerosing cholangitis, and with increased cholestasis in primary sclerosing cholangitis. ANCA of defined specificities had only limited clinical relevance. CONCLUSIONS: ANCA as detected by indirect immunofluorescence seem associated with a more severe course of autoimmune liver disease. The target antigens for ANCA in these diseases include catalase, alpha-enolase, and lactoferrin. Assessment of the antigenic specificities of ANCA in autoimmune liver disease does not significantly contribute to their clinical significance.  相似文献

BackgroundOverlap syndrome is a term used for overlapping features of autoimmune hepatitis and primary sclerosing cholangitis or primary biliary cirrhosis and for autoimmune cholangitis. We describe a high prevalence of small duct primary sclerosing cholangitis among patients with overlapping autoimmune hepatitis and primary sclerosing cholangitis.MethodsWe sought to retrieve all patients with overlap syndrome between primary sclerosing cholangitis and autoimmune hepatitis in six university hospitals in Sweden. The revised autoimmune hepatitis scoring system proposed by the International Autoimmune Hepatitis Group was used to establish the diagnosis autoimmune hepatitis. Endoscopic retrograde cholangiography and/or magnetic resonance cholangiography were used to separate the primary sclerosing cholangitis cases diagnosed through liver biopsy into small and large primary sclerosing cholangitis. A histologocial diagnosis compatible with both autoimmune hepatitis and primary sclerosing cholangitis was required for inclusion.Results26 patients fulfilled our criteria for histological overlap of autoimmune hepatitis and primary sclerosing cholangitis, 7 (27%) of which had small duct primary sclerosing cholangitis. The reliability of the diagnosis small duct primary sclerosing cholangitis was supported by a very close similarity between small and large duct primary sclerosing cholangitis patients in clinical and laboratory data, and by a poor response to immunosuppressive therapy in the small duct primary sclerosing cholangitis patients. Patients with large duct overlap syndrome had a good response to immunosuppressive therapy. In both groups, our limited experience from ursodeoxycholic acid was largely poor.ConclusionsSmall duct primary sclerosing cholangitis is prevalent in the overlap syndrome between autoimmune hepatitis and primary sclerosing cholangitis.  相似文献

肝脏组织学在自身免疫性肝病的诊断中起着重要作用,尤其是临床表现非特异、自身抗体阴性的患者。介绍了几种自身免疫性肝病在组织学上的特征性表现。自身免疫性肝炎(AIH)的特征性表现包括界面性肝炎伴淋巴-浆细胞浸润、玫瑰花环及穿入现象,而慢性非化脓性胆管炎、上皮样肉芽肿常提示原发性胆汁性肝硬化(PBC)。胆管周围洋葱皮样纤维化是原发性硬化性胆管炎(PSC)特征性表现,席纹状纤维化伴IgG4阳性浆细胞浸润常须考虑为IgG4相关硬化性胆管炎。最后指出,在日常工作中,临床医生和病理医生加强沟通有利于提高自身免疫性肝病的诊治。  相似文献

Autoimmune hepatitis has two major variant phenotypes in which the features of classical disease are co-mingled with those of primary biliary cirrhosis or primary sclerosing cholangitis. These overlap syndromes lack codified diagnostic criteria, established pathogenic mechanisms, and confident management strategies. Their clinical importance relates mainly to the identification of patients who respond poorly to conventional corticosteroid treatment. Scoring systems that lack discriminative power have been used in their definition, and a clinical phenotype based on pre-defined laboratory and histological findings has not been promulgated. The frequency of overlap with primary biliary cirrhosis is 7–13 %, and the frequency of overlap with primary sclerosing cholangitis is 8–17 %. Patients with autoimmune hepatitis and features of cholestatic disease must be distinguished from patients with cholestatic disease and features of autoimmune hepatitis. Variants of the overlap syndromes include patients with small duct primary sclerosing cholangitis, antimitochondrial antibody-negative primary biliary cirrhosis, autoimmune sclerosing cholangitis, and immunoglobulin G4-associated disease. Conventional corticosteroid therapy alone or in conjunction with ursodeoxycholic acid (13–15 mg/kg daily) has been variably effective, and cyclosporine, mycophenolate mofetil, and budesonide have been beneficial in selected patients. The key cholestatic features that influence the prognosis of autoimmune hepatitis must be defined and incorporated into the definition of the syndrome rather than rely on designations that imply the co-mingling of different diseases with manifestations of variable clinical relevance. The overlap syndromes in autoimmune hepatitis are imprecise, heterogeneous, and unfounded, but they constitute a clinical reality that must be accepted, diagnosed, refined, treated, and studied.  相似文献

The headword “overlap syndromes” of liver diseases includes the coexistence of autoimmune hepatitis, primary biliary cirrhosis, and primary sclerosing cholangitis. These syndromes often represent a diagnostic and therapeutic challenge for hepatologists; it remains unclear whether these overlap syndromes form distinct entities or they are only variants of the major autoimmune liver diseases. The most frequent reported association occurs between autoimmune hepatitis and primary biliary cirrhosis, whereas the overlap between autoimmune hepatitis and primary sclerosing cholangitis is less frequent, typically at young age and often attendant with an inflammatory bowel disease. The choice therapy is based on ursodeoxycholic acid and immunosuppressive drugs, used at the same time or consecutively, according to the course of disease. The diagnostic scores for autoimmune hepatitis can help for diagnosis, even though their definitive soundness is lacking.  相似文献

Primary sclerosing cholangitis in children   总被引:5,自引:0,他引:5  
Primary sclerosing cholangitis (PSC), a chronic inflammatory process affecting the extrahepatic and/or medium to large bile ducts, is not rare in children. It has features suggesting an autoimmune pathogenesis, although the mechanism of tissue damage remains unknown. The clinical presentation of childhood primary sclerosing cholangitis is highly variable and frequently without obvious features of cholestasis. Clinical similarity to autoimmune hepatitis is common. Association with chronic colitis is less common than in adults. Cholangiography is essential for the diagnosis and examination of the medium to large intrahepatic ducts is mandatory, as 40% of children lack extrahepatic duct involvement. Histological findings may help to distinguish childhood PSC from autoimmune hepatitis. In children, sclerosing cholangitis may also develop secondary to other disease processes, notably Langerhans histiocytosis, congenital immunodeficiencies and cystic fibrosis. Neonatal sclerosing cholangitis is chronic inflammatory disease of bile ducts which presents initially with neonatal cholestasis; its pathogenesis remains uncertain and may not be the same as for primary sclerosing cholangitis. Effective treatment modalities for childhood PSC remain undetermined. Liver transplantation is required for children who progress to biliary cirrhosis and hepatic decompensation.  相似文献

Background/AimPlasma cells infiltrate in the liver is a prototype lesion of autoimmune liver diseases. The possible role of plasma cells isotyping (IgM and IgG) in the liver in the diagnostic definition of autoimmune liver disease, and particularly in variant syndromes such as autoimmune cholangitis and the primary biliary cirrhosis/autoimmune hepatitis overlap syndrome, is less defined.MethodsWe analysed the clinical, serological and histological features of 83 patients with autoimmune liver disease (40 primary biliary cirrhosis, 20 autoimmune hepatitis, 13 primary sclerosing cholangitis, 4 autoimmune cholangitis and 6 overlap syndrome) compared to 34 patients with chronic hepatitis C and evaluated the expression of IgM and IgG plasma cells in their liver by immunostaining.ResultsBy Spearman's correlation, the mean-counts of IgM plasma cells in portal tracts were significantly correlated with female gender, serum alkaline phosphatase, gamma-glutamyl transferase and IgM values, positivity for anti-mitochondrial antibody-M2 and, on liver biopsy, with bile duct changes, orcein-positive granules and granulomas. Whereas IgG plasma cells resulted more correlated with alanine aminotransferase levels. IgG/IgM ratio lower than 1 was found no only in primary biliary cirrhosis but also in all patients with autoimmune cholangitis. Conversely, all patients with overlap syndrome showed IgG/IgM ratio higher than 1.ConclusionImmunostaining for IgM and IgG plasma cells on liver tissue can be a valuable parameter for better diagnosis of autoimmune liver disease and also for variant or mixed syndromes.  相似文献

Immunohistochemical evidence for hepatic progenitor cells in liver diseases   总被引:11,自引:0,他引:11  
BACKGROUND/AIM: Proliferative bile ductular reactions occur in a variety of liver diseases in humans. It is a matter of debate whether such reactions result from progenitor cell proliferation with biliary and hepatocytic differentiation, versus biliary metaplasia of damaged hepatocytes. We investigated bile ductular reactions in liver diseases, paying particular attention to the presence of cells with intermediate (hepatocytic/biliary) features (oval-like cells). METHODS: Five specimens each were selected of submassive hepatic necrosis and cirrhosis due to hepatitis B, hepatitis C, autoimmune hepatitis, alcohol injury, primary biliary cirrhosis and primary sclerosing cholangitis. Immunohistochemical stains were performed for biliary markers (cytokeratins [CKs] 7 and 19), as well as hepatocytic markers (HepParl and alpha-fetoprotein[AFP]) in sequential sections. The degree of staining of each cell type (biliary, hepatocytic, intermediate) was graded semiquantitatively. RESULTS: Hepatocytes always stained diffusely for HepParl, occasionally for CK7, and rarely for CK19. Biliary cells were always diffusely positive for CK7 and CK19, and rarely for HepParl. Intermediate cells were identified in all cases and showed widespread staining for both HepParl and CK7, and less commonly for CK19. AFP was not expressed in any cell type. The morphologic and immunohistochemical features of bile ductular reactions were similar in the different diseases. CONCLUSIONS: Proliferating hepatic parenchymal cells with intermediate (hepatocytic/biliary) morphologic features and combined immunophenotype can be identified in a variety of acute and chronic liver diseases. The similarity of bile ductular reactions among chronic hepatitic, alcoholic and biliary diseases suggests that they result from proliferation of oval-like progenitor cells.  相似文献

Fractalkine is a chemokine with both chemoattractant and cell-adhesive functions, and in the intestine it is involved with its receptor CX3CR1 in the chemoattraction and recruitment of intraepithelial lymphocytes. We examined the pathophysiological roles of fractalkine and CX3CR1 in normal and diseased bile ducts. Expression of fractalkine and CX3CR1 were examined in liver tissues from patients with primary biliary cirrhosis (17 cases) and controls (9 cases of primary sclerosing cholangitis, 10 cases of extrahepatic biliary obstruction, 20 cases of chronic viral hepatitis C, and 18 cases of histologically normal livers). Expression of fractalkine in biliary epithelial cells (BECs) in response to cytokine treatments was examined using a human cholangiocarcinoma cell line (HuCC-T1) and human intrahepatic BEC line. The chemotaxis of CX3CR1-expressing monocytes (THP-1) toward fractalkine was assayed using chemotaxis chambers. Fractalkine messenger RNA/protein were expressed on BECs of normal and diseased bile ducts, and their expression was upregulated in injured bile ducts of primary biliary cirrhosis. CX3CR1 was expressed on infiltrating mononuclear cells in portal tracts and on CD3(+), CD4(+), and CD8(+) intraepithelial lymphocytes of injured bile ducts in primary biliary cirrhosis. Fractalkine messenger RNA expression was upregulated in two cultured BECs on treatment with lipopolysaccharide and Th1-cytokines (interleukin 1beta, interferon gamma, and tumor necrosis factor alpha). THP-1 cells showed chemotaxis toward fractalkine secreted by cultured cells. In conclusion, Th1-cytokine predominance and lipopolysaccharide in the microenvironment of injured bile ducts resulting from primary biliary cirrhosis induce the upregulation of fractalkine expression in BECs, followed by the chemoattraction of CX3CR1-expressing mononuclear cells, including CD4(+) and CD8(+) T cells, and their adhesion to BECs and the accumulation of biliary intraepithelial lymphocytes.  相似文献

The histological features and type of mononuclear cell infiltrate in gall bladders from six patients with primary sclerosing cholangitis were studied using routine staining techniques and immunohistochemistry. Control studies were performed using the gall bladders from six patients (age and sex matched) with chronic cholecystitis and four with primary biliary cirrhosis. A range of histological abnormalities was present in gall bladders from patients with primary sclerosing cholangitis including a mild to moderate degree of epithelial hyperplasia, pseudogland formation, and mononuclear cell infiltrate of the epithelium; moderate to severe chronic inflammatory cell infiltrate and fibrosis affecting the superficial and deep layers of the gall bladder wall; and minimal smooth muscle hypertrophy. These abnormalities were non-specific and were also present in gall bladders from patients with chronic cholecystitis and primary biliary cirrhosis. Vasculitis and granulomas were not present in the patients with primary sclerosing cholangitis. Immunohistochemistry showed that the superficial and deep mononuclear cell infiltrate in primary sclerosing cholangitis gall bladders was composed predominantly of lymphocytes, in contrast to chronic cholecystitis where macrophages were found in similar or greater numbers. Moreover, T lymphocytes (activated and resting) were present throughout the lymphocytic infiltrate and were apposed to the base and interdigitated between the biliary epithelial cells in significantly greater numbers than in chronic cholecystitis gall bladders. B lymphocytes were present only in lymphoid follicles. Comparative studies using liver biopsy specimens from three of the primary sclerosing cholangitis patients showed a similar T lymphocyte portal tract infiltrate. We conclude that a number of non-specific chronic inflammatory histological abnormalities were present in primary sclerosing cholangitis gall bladders. Immunohistochemistry found other features that were present in this disease - a predominantly lymphocytic mononuclear cell infiltrate of the superficial and deep layers of the gall bladder wall and the presence of T lymphocytes that infiltrated the biliary epithelial cells. These findings support the hypothesis that aberrant cell mediated immune mechanisms may play a role in the pathogenesis of both the intrahepatic and extrahepatic lesions in primary sclerosing cholangitis.  相似文献

BACKGROUND: CD40-CD154 is a receptor-ligand pair that provides key communication signals between cells of the adaptive immune system in states of inflammation and autoimmunity. The CD40 receptor is expressed constitutively on B lymphocytes, for which it provides important signals regulating clonal expansion and antibody production. CD154 is a member of the tumor necrosis factor superfamily, which is primarily expressed by activated T cells. METHODS: Because many chronic liver diseases are characterized by lymphocytic infiltration of the liver and several have increased immunoglobulin (Ig) production, the role of CD40-CD154 in hepatic Ig production was investigated in patients with primary biliary cirrhosis (PBC), primary sclerosing cholangitis, autoimmune hepatitis (AIH), hepatitis C, hepatitis B, alcoholic and non-alcoholic steatohepatitis, as well as normal controls. RESULTS: Soluble CD154 levels in the serum were found to be no different in chronic liver diseases vs normal controls. Likewise, CD154 mRNA levels in peripheral blood mononuclear cells did not differ. However, mRNA for CD154 was significantly increased in the liver of individuals with PBC and AIH as compared with the other groups. The quantity of CD154 mRNA in the liver correlated positively with the quantity of mRNA for secretory Ig. CONCLUSION: These findings suggest that CD40-CD154 signals may be involved in Ig production within the liver of autoimmune liver diseases.  相似文献

We report on a patient who was diagnosed six years before with celiac disease, with a current combined problem of asplenism, mesenteric cysts and elevated liver function tests. The implications of splenic atrophy mimic those of post-splenectomy patients. Mesenteric lymph node cavitation is a rare complication of celiac disease that is most often associated with splenic atrophy. The pathogenesis is unknown. The clinical implications of the cavitated mesenteric lymph nodes are unclear. The association of celiac disease with liver disease was reported many years ago, but only recently these associations have been more clearly defined. Liver involvement shows a clinical spectrum varying from nonspecific reactive hepatitis, chronic active hepatitis, steatohepatitis to frank cirrhosis. Associations with autoimmune hepatitis, autoimmune cholangitis, primary biliary cirrhosis and primary sclerosing cholangitis have been described. In our patient, we found no obvious cause for the necrotizing hepatitis and the negative auto-antibodies made it impossible to firmly establish the diagnosis of autoimmune hepatitis. The causal relationship with celiac disease, if any, remains unproven.  相似文献
